Web30 de jun. de 2024 · Pack prepared beets into hot jars, leaving 1 inch of headspace. If desired, add up to 1 teaspoon of canning or pickling salt per quart or ½ teaspoon per pint. Fill jar to 1 inch from the top with fresh boiling water. (Do not use the water beets were cooked in; it is dirty!) Remove air bubbles. Wipe jar rims with a clean damp paper towel. Web1 de jul. de 2024 · Place jars in a canner filled halfway with warm (120 to 140°F) water. Add hot water to 1 inch above jars. Heat the water and maintain a 180°F water temperature for 30 minutes. Use a calibrated thermometer clipped to the side of the pot to be certain that the water temperature is at least 180°F during the entire 30 minutes.
